|
Stock-Based Compensation - Additional Information (Detail)
|3 Months Ended
|6 Months Ended
|12 Months Ended
|
Jul. 31, 2020
USD ($)
shares
|
Jul. 31, 2020
USD ($)
shares
|
Jul. 31, 2019
USD ($)
|
Jul. 31, 2020
USD ($)
$ / shares
shares
|
Jul. 31, 2019
USD ($)
|
Jan. 31, 2020
USD ($)
$ / shares
shares
|
Jan. 31, 2019
USD ($)
$ / shares
shares
|
Jan. 31, 2018
USD ($)
$ / shares
shares
|Unrecognized compensation costs period for recognition
|3 years 6 months 7 days
|Unrecognized compensation costs | $
|$ 30,700,000
|$ 30,700,000
|$ 30,700,000
|Share-based payment arrangement expense | $
|13,269,000
|$ 2,492,000
|$ 14,320,000
|$ 3,601,000
|$ 5,745,000
|$ 4,095,000
|$ 3,826,000
|Share-based Payment Arrangement
|Number of equity plans
|2
|Options expire period
|0
|Share-based Payment Arrangement | Employees, Non-employee Directors and Consultants
|Options expire period
|0
|Share-based Payment Arrangement | Maximum
|Number of shares authorized (in shares)
|9,000,000
|Exercise price of options, percentage of fair market value of common stock
|100.00%
|Share-based Payment Arrangement | 2014 Equity Incentive Plan
|Number of shares authorized (in shares)
|15,025,666
|Number of additional shares authorized (in shares)
|6,797,476
|Award vesting period
|4 years
|Share-based Payment Arrangement | 2019 Equity Incentive Plan
|Number of shares authorized (in shares)
|1,500,000
|Number of additional shares authorized (in shares)
|15,250,000
|Percent increase in aggregate shares
|5.00%
|Share-based Payment Arrangement | 2019 Equity Incentive Plan | Maximum
|Number of shares authorized (in shares)
|7,500,000
|Restricted Stock Units (RSUs)
|Award vesting period
|4 years
|4 years
|Options expire period
|0
|Unrecognized compensation costs | $
|$ 19,600,000
|RSUs granted
|1,120,054
|948,119
|Weighted-average grant date fair value | $ / shares
|$ 20.07
|$ 21.75
|RSUs vested
|17,500
|0
|RSUs forfeited or cancelled
|9,580
|0
|Intrinsic value of unvested restricted stock units | $
|$ 0.0
|Award vesting rights, percentage
|25.00%
|Share-based payment arrangement expense | $
|$ 12,200,000
|Stock Option
|Award vesting period
|4 years
|Unrecognized compensation costs period for recognition
|1 year 6 months 10 days
|4 years
|Grant date weighted average fair value of options issued, net of forfeitures, | $ / shares
|$ 6.74
|$ 5.36
|$ 2.13
|Stock options granted
|353,900
|Unrecognized compensation costs | $
|$ 5,500,000
|$ 5,500,000
|$ 5,500,000
|$ 7,600,000
|Stock Option | Maximum
|Award vesting period
|10 years
|Stock Option | Minimum
|Award vesting period
|4 years
|1 year 7 months 24 days
|Employee Stock | Employee Stock Purchase Plan
|Number of shares authorized (in shares)
|1,800,000
|1,800,000
|1,800,000
|Percent increase in aggregate shares
|1.00%
|Purchase price of common stock, percent
|85.00%
|X
- Definition
+ References
Number Of Equity Incentive Plans
+ Details
No definition available.
|X
- Definition
+ References
Share Based Compensation Arrangement By Share Based Payment Award Percent Increase In Aggregate Shares
+ Details
No definition available.
|X
- Definition
+ References
Stock Option Grant Exercise Price Percentage Of Fair Market Value
+ Details
No definition available.
|X
- Definition
+ References
Amount of expense for award under share-based payment arrangement. Excludes amount capitalized.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Amount of cost not yet recognized for nonvested award under share-based payment arrangement.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Weighted-average period over which cost not yet recognized is expected to be recognized for award under share-based payment arrangement, in 'PnYnMnDTnHnMnS' format, for example, 'P1Y5M13D' represents reported fact of one year, five months, and thirteen days.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Period over which grantee's right to exercise award under share-based payment arrangement is no longer contingent on satisfaction of service or performance condition, in 'PnYnMnDTnHnMnS' format, for example, 'P1Y5M13D' represents reported fact of one year, five months, and thirteen days. Includes, but is not limited to, combination of market, performance or service condition.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
The number of equity-based payment instruments, excluding stock (or unit) options, that were forfeited during the reporting period.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
The number of grants made during the period on other than stock (or unit) option plans (for example, phantom stock or unit plan, stock or unit appreciation rights plan, performance target plan).
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
The weighted average fair value at grant date for nonvested equity-based awards issued during the period on other than stock (or unit) option plans (for example, phantom stock or unit plan, stock or unit appreciation rights plan, performance target plan).
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
The number of equity-based payment instruments, excluding stock (or unit) options, that vested during the reporting period.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Number of additional shares authorized for issuance under share-based payment arrangement.
+ Details
No definition available.
|X
- Definition
+ References
Number of shares authorized for issuance under share-based payment arrangement.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Number of options or other stock instruments for which the right to exercise has lapsed under the terms of the plan agreements.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Net number of share options (or share units) granted during the period.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
The weighted average grant-date fair value of options granted during the reporting period as calculated by applying the disclosed option pricing methodology.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Percentage of vesting of award under share-based payment arrangement.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Intrinsic value of nonvested award under share-based payment arrangement. Excludes share and unit options.
+ Details
No definition available.
|X
- Definition
+ References
Purchase price of common stock expressed as a percentage of its fair value.
+ Details
No definition available.
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details